mirror of
https://github.com/archlinux/aur.git
synced 2026-03-09 13:50:13 +01:00
- Complete dependency set including waybar and python-requests - Standard AUR post_install pattern (no automatic service enabling) - Clear user instructions for setup and service enabling - Follows Arch Linux packaging best practices - Ready for production use
49 lines
790 B
Text
49 lines
790 B
Text
post_install() {
|
|
cat <<'EOF'
|
|
|
|
hyprwhspr installed successfully!
|
|
|
|
To complete setup:
|
|
hyprwhspr-setup
|
|
|
|
To enable services:
|
|
systemctl --user enable --now ydotoold.service hyprwhspr.service
|
|
|
|
IMPORTANT: Log out and log back in for permissions to take effect
|
|
(Required for /dev/uinput access)
|
|
|
|
Check status:
|
|
systemctl --user status hyprwhspr.service
|
|
|
|
Logs:
|
|
journalctl --user -u hyprwhspr.service
|
|
|
|
EOF
|
|
}
|
|
|
|
post_upgrade() {
|
|
cat <<'EOF'
|
|
|
|
hyprwhspr upgraded.
|
|
|
|
If needed, re-run setup (idempotent):
|
|
hyprwhspr-setup
|
|
|
|
Service status:
|
|
systemctl --user status ydotoold.service
|
|
systemctl --user status hyprwhspr.service
|
|
|
|
EOF
|
|
}
|
|
|
|
post_remove() {
|
|
cat <<'EOF'
|
|
|
|
hyprwhspr removed.
|
|
|
|
Note: user data remains (remove manually if desired):
|
|
~/.config/hyprwhspr
|
|
~/.local/share/hyprwhspr
|
|
|
|
EOF
|
|
}
|